C7JFM Posted May 10, 2002 Share Posted May 10, 2002 why do the right hand webers run much richer (on inspection of the plugs ) than the left hand side when the jets etc are the same both sides and the carbs are balanced evenly ? Casbar Posted May 10, 2002 Share Posted May 10, 2002 Chris, May be off base here, but my understanding is that the only way to see if the carbs are running rich, is either do a plug chop with the engine under load, or get it checked on a rolling road. If you just take the plugs out after the engine has been running, then you won't get the true picture. The mixture screws can effect the plugs at tickover and upto around 3000 revs. I expect someone more knowledgable will be along with a more tech view later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
